Too often do we as conservatives become lost in the big picture. We worry about statistics and analytics, but in doing so, we risk forgetting what exactly it is that we are fighting for: the American dream.
Congressman Byron Donalds, Representative for Florida’s 19th district, experienced the American dream recently while watching his son play basketball. He spoke of this experience on Friday, February 21, 2025, on the CPAC stage.
At the beginning of his speech, Donalds shouted out his wife, Erika, a school choice activist who had spoken about the topic on an earlier panel. He spoke of his son’s dedication to the game of basketball and his years of hard work.
Even when Donald’s colleagues were texting him about politics, and President Donald Trump called him about a Truth Social post, Donalds had one thing on his mind: his son’s success.
Though many may be shocked by this, Donalds explained, “I know we’re supposed to be talking about politics in the golden age of America and making America great again, but I will tell you, part of the golden age of our nation is the success of our children and grandchildren.”
Donalds spoke about the most important aspect of politics, an aspect that the conservative movement should never keep out of its mind – the human aspect. While we all must strive to make America great again, we must never lose focus on who we are making America great again for.
